Viticulture
The grape (Pedro Ximénez), the soil (Albariza) and the climate (extreme summer) are determining factors in the viticulture of Montilla wines.
Soils
Albarizas (white loam, chalky) soil
Climate
Continental. Hot days/cool nights during growing season. Semi arid.
Winemaking
Alvear’s Medium Dry combines the biological aging of a Fino, aged under the “Velo de Flor”, and the oxidative aging of an Oloroso. It is slightly sweetened and stays in a Solera System of American oak casks for more than 7 years.
Aging
First: Criaderas and solera system, traditional method involving rows of casks of American oak under a clear layer of yeast know as the “Velo de flor”. Second.: oxidative aging (like a oloroso wine). At least 7 years.

Serving suggestion: Ideal as an aperitif with nuts, with onion soup, charcuterie and cheese as Cheddar or Gouda. Perfect for cocktails. Try it with Mexican and Thai food. Brilliant dark oak colour and classic aromas of toasted nuts. Off dry but fuller bodied than a Fino. Nice length in mouth and nose.
